CareCredit: A Flexible Health and Wellness Credit Card

CareCredit offers a health and wellness credit card that provides a convenient way to finance cosmetic and plastic surgery procedures. This card allows individuals to make easy monthly payments, subject to credit approval, making it a viable option for managing the costs of cosmetic surgery. The card can be used for a wide range of procedures, from surgical options like breast augmentation and tummy tucks to non-surgical treatments such as BOTOX® and dermal fillers (source).

One of the key benefits of CareCredit is its wide acceptance, with over 285,000 locations across the United States, including healthcare providers and retail locations. This accessibility makes it an attractive choice for those seeking cosmetic surgery financing. Additionally, CareCredit offers promotional financing options and has no annual fee, enhancing its appeal for long-term financial planning (source).

Cherry Payment Plans: Flexible and User-Friendly

Cherry Payment Plans provide another flexible financing option for cosmetic surgery, allowing patients to split costs into manageable installments ranging from $200 to $50,000. This includes interest-free plans and competitive fixed interest rates, making it easier for patients to afford procedures without financial strain. The application process is quick and user-friendly, taking only 60 seconds with no hard credit check, ensuring that patients’ credit scores are not negatively impacted (source).

Cherry also offers significant benefits to plastic surgery practices by providing full payment upfront, improving cash flow, and reducing the burden of in-house financing management. Practices receive payments within 2-3 business days, and Cherry assumes all risk associated with patient financing. This model is transparent, with no origination fees, prepayment penalties, or deferred interest traps, ensuring a straightforward and predictable payment experience for patients (source).

Alphaeon Credit: Special Financing for Medical Procedures

Alphaeon Credit offers a flexible financing solution for cosmetic surgery and other medical procedures, allowing individuals to pre-qualify without impacting their credit score. This feature provides a convenient way for potential patients to explore their financing options without the fear of affecting their credit. The card provides special financing options for purchases over $250, with credit lines available up to $25,000, making it accessible to a broader audience (source).

Exploring Other Financing Options

In addition to specialized credit cards, other financing options for cosmetic surgery include unsecured personal loans, personal credit cards, and in-house financing plans offered by some plastic surgeons. Unsecured personal loans can be a viable option for those who do not have immediate funds available, but they should be considered carefully in terms of their impact on financial health. Personal credit cards offer convenience, especially if a promotional 0% APR can be secured, but it is crucial to pay off the balance before the promotional period ends to avoid high-interest charges (source).

Some individuals may also consider borrowing from a 401(k) account or using a home equity loan, though these options come with their own risks and considerations. Ultimately, choosing the right financing option for cosmetic surgery is a personal decision that should consider both personal well-being and financial implications (source).
